Ben Calvert and the Swifts - The Creatures of Simplicity"






Melancholy story telling, delicate arrangement. A murder in the forest.





















A beautiful acoustic folk song, with a beautiful music video to boot. A three piece from the midlands, "the Creatures of Simplicity" came out last year with the download you get one custom made playing card specially made from the video that we`ve included, and a DVD. They are also a part of Boehemian Jukebox, which has for the last five years been putting on live events in Birmingham consisting of acts from all over the world who are signed to folkesque small indie labels, people who are on the more hardcore side of folk, and electronic - based bands that are really suited a more intimate setting but can`t find a place to play amongst the ravers and lazers.


Formed in September 2010, these lot have been the support act to The Jeffrey Lewis & Peter Stampfel Band and have also played to a packed out Birmingham Symphony hall, nay bad for a start off. Check out Festive Road, their current album out on bandcamp, because the quality doesn`t just stop at this single ("Everyone loves Lucy" was made for a summer afternoon in Hyde park). Can`t stress enough how good the lyrical content is, Ben is a natural storyteller.

Bohemian Jukebox happens every 2nd Sunday of the month at the Bull’s Head. Moseley, Birmingham.
